2009 Chevrolet Captiva vs. 2004 GMC Canyon
To start off, 2009 Chevrolet Captiva is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 GMC Canyon.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 GMC Canyon would be higher. At 3,458 cc (5 cylinders), 2004 GMC Canyon is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 GMC Canyon (220 HP) has 86 more horse power than 2009 Chevrolet Captiva. (134 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2004 GMC Canyon should accelerate faster than 2009 Chevrolet Captiva.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 GMC Canyon weights approximately 110 kg more than 2009 Chevrolet Captiva.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2004 GMC Canyon (305 Nm) has 85 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Chevrolet Captiva. (220 Nm). This means 2004 GMC Canyon will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Chevrolet Captiva.
Compare all specifications:
2009 Chevrolet Captiva | 2004 GMC Canyon | |
Make | Chevrolet | GMC |
Model | Captiva | Canyon |
Year Released | 2009 | 2004 |
Body Type | SUV | Pickup |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2405 cc | 3458 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 5 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 134 HP | 220 HP |
Torque | 220 Nm | 305 Nm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.6:1 | 10.0:1 |
Number of Seats | 7 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1845 kg | 1955 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4640 mm | 5270 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1760 mm | 1720 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1860 mm | 1660 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2710 mm | 3210 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 9.6 L/100km | 11.8 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 65 L | 72 L |
